THT Lab - Laboratory of Technology for High Temperature

The THT-Lab (Laboratory of Technology for High Temperature), located at the DIEF site in Calenzano ([link posizione]), hosts the infrastructure required for the experimental activities of the HTC Group, mainly focused on the study of heat transfer and combustion phenomena in turbomachinery. The laboratory includes four main facilities:

Low TRL test cell (TRL 2–3)

  • Ambient pressure and temperature
  • Flow rates up to 2 kg/s through a double-stage centrifugal fan (90 kW)

Medium-high temperature test cell (TRL 4)

  • Pressure up to 10 bar; temperature up to 450 °C via an electric heater (600 kW)
  • Flow rates up to 1 kg/s through two screw compressors (250 kW)

Combustion test cell (TRL 5-6)

  • Pressure up to 10 bar; flow rates up to 1 kg/s through two screw compressors (250 kW)
  • Capability to test various types of fuels, as liquid fuels, natural gas, hydrogen

Rotating test rigs cell

  • Rotating rig for the study of stator/rotor cavities and sealing systems (3000 rpm)
  • Rotating rig for the study of high-speed gearbox housings with lubrication (6000 rpm)
  • Rotating rig for the study of cooling systems for scaled-up turbine blades (300 rpm)

A second low-TRL testing facility is located at the School of Engineering site. (Colonne Lab).

The laboratory is also equipped with the necessary instrumentation for experimental characterization, including surface temperature measurement systems (infrared thermographic cameras, thermochromic liquid crystals), laser velocimetry (PIV), hot wire anemometry and pneumatic probes for flow and turbulence measurements, high-speed cameras (up to 200 kHz), laser-based combustion diagnostics systems (OH* chemiluminescence).

Finally, the laboratory includes dedicated areas for joint research programs with industrial partners, such as the ComHeat Lab, a joint laboratory between DIEF and Avio Aero.
